AST Level 12019-12-07T00:00:00Avalanche Skills Training Level 1 is a must for everyone heading into the backcountry. Learn about avalanche formation and release, how to identify avalanche terrain, the basics of trip planning, how to use avalanche for ecasts, travel techniques in avalanche terrain and an intro to companion rescue. This course requires an intermediate level skiing or snowboarding ability. For ages 30+.

AST Level 22019-12-21T00:00:00For those who have taken Avalanche Skills Training Level 1 and have solid experience in the backcountry. In AST Level 2 you will learn progressive planning and travel techniques required to travel safely through various types of terrain, how to use the Danger Rating on a local scale, how to apply the Avalanche Terrain Exposure Scale model to develop terrain ratings and proficiently carry out a companion rescue. This course includes one day in the classroom and three days in the backcountry (Golden area). For ages 30+.
